English: The Coast Guard Cutter Bertholf receives supplies during an airdrop from an Air Station Kodiak HC-130 Hercules airplane in the Arctic Ocean, Sept. 14, 2012. By working together, the Bertholf is able to stay underway conducting operations without having to come back to port. The Bertholf is currently on patrol as part of Operation Arctic Shield.
